Output e19c27a84d935d0326a88bceebff7c9cb3225009fc8e374c1b6a74e9e6f97615:0

value
525650
script pubkey
OP_0 OP_PUSHBYTES_20 cae1d58dddeb2cdfc0de5b0385b2d91bf7d43a8e
address
bc1qetsatrwaavkdlsx7tvpctvker0magw5w49z73x
transaction
e19c27a84d935d0326a88bceebff7c9cb3225009fc8e374c1b6a74e9e6f97615
confirmations
144742
spent
true